If you’re able to substitute white sugar over brown sugar without changing the taste too much, this may help prolong the shelf life of your cookies. White sugar has lower moisture content than brown sugar or icing sugars, and it’s less likely to go rancid. The raw meringue will last in the refrigerator for an average of 2 to 3 days. Italian meringue lasts in the refrigerator for up to 5 days, because the egg whites are cooked. And the dry or cooked meringue – which is also called bakery meringue, is kept in perfect condition for 1 year.How Long Do Oreos Last? For longer storage time, store them in an airtight container or wrap them in plastic …Baked cookies will keep in the freezer for as much as 3 or 4 weeks. After baking, permit cookies to cool entirely. Put them in a single layer on a parchment-lined baking sheet to freeze them, then store them in a freezer-safe zip-top storage bag identified with the name and date.Are you craving the delicious taste of Girl Scout cookies?
